Posted by PunkINa5.SLOW (Member # 10) on :
 
302 and 289 heads will not fit on a 351 unless you have them drilled for 1/2 head bolts.

The deck heights are different too. 8.2 Versus 9.2 and or 9.5 depending on which 351W.

Oil pans are different

Dist. different

Headers/exhaust manifolds different.

Modifications for front accessories necessary due to 1 inch taller deck height.

Other than that you are oK

Clevelands are entirely different motors.

Posted by PunkINa5.SLOW (Member # 10) on :
 
They sent Ted a CUSTOM cam and it is just a reboxed TFS stage 1.

They also sent him the heads didnt say what plugs to use, didnt advice of smog port plugs needed and didnt advice of reducers needed.

The heads have a machined recess that looks like ARP washer would take up the slack for (7/16 to 1/2 inch) and act as the washers do when using 7/16 on TFS heads but they actually required the spacers.

They didnt send. Just a shady deal they didnt seem to know much about their product on the phone nor the install and reboxing a TFS Stage 1 cam and calling it custom??

Come on now.

I have heard GOOD things from them tho.
